Horizon’s STEM Kits introduce students to the fascinating science behind renewable energy technology. They will unearth the key principles of renewable energy and
understanding the various engineering mechanisms behind it through various experiments.
Applied Science • Environmental Science • Sustainability
Learning environmental scienceRenewable Energy Science Kits
Students will explore what makes a “Green Building” and find out how “clean energy” is produced from renewable energy sources.

E.g How do lightning detectors work? Commercial lightning detectors can be rather expensive; therefore students can work on turning Arduino into a lightning detector. The aim is to construct a simple circuit to detect lightning with an Arduino and produce meaningful results.
Allow students to investigate their interest in science and technology in a unique way.
E.g Students will use the Arduino with both analogue inputs and outputs in a sketch. Students will be able to maintain lighting levels using a Photoresistor.
Learn the basics of digital technologies that is required to control digital actuators and to read digital sensors.
E.g. Students will understand how electricity flows through a circuit and will be able to use that knowledge to light an LED using Arduino.
